Zcash (ZEC) delivered a robust performance on Tuesday, April 7, advancing more than 5% from $256.45 to approximately $269. Currently, ZEC is changing hands at $269.66 with a market valuation of $4.48 billion, per CoinMarketCap data.

The 24-hour trading volume hit $458.23 million, representing a substantial 50.1% increase. This elevated activity suggests heightened buyer engagement across leading trading platforms.
Looking at the weekly performance, ZEC has appreciated 7.13%. This upward movement stands in contrast to the broader cryptocurrency market, which has largely traded sideways or declined during the same period.
The rally has pushed ZEC into a critical resistance zone around $270, an area that has previously rejected multiple upward attempts over recent months. Whether the price can break through and sustain above this threshold is now the focal point for market participants.
Additionally, ZEC has successfully recaptured its daily 50-day exponential moving average (50 EMA). This marks the first reclaim since the token declined from higher valuations earlier this year. Technical analysts view this recovery as an indication of changing market sentiment.
Crypto market analyst Ardi has identified a dual-level breakout configuration. ZEC is simultaneously testing horizontal resistance near $270 and a descending trendline that has constrained price action since January. A decisive daily close above this confluence would eliminate both obstacles in a single move.
Should this breakout materialize, technical strategists anticipate price advancement toward $300 as the subsequent significant level. In the event of rejection, ZEC may retrace to the $200–$220 demand region.
Analyst Whales_Crypto_Trading has drawn attention to a falling wedge formation visible on the 12-hour timeframe. This chart pattern frequently precedes bullish reversals. The analyst has outlined near-term objectives around $300, with an extended target of $600 if bullish momentum persists.
The daily Relative Strength Index currently registers approximately 63. This reading indicates solid buying momentum while remaining outside overbought territory. The MACD indicator is likewise displaying bullish signals, with its lines crossing upward.
Both the 50-day and 200-day simple moving averages are positioned beneath the current price point, confirming an established uptrend structure.
Bollinger Bands have begun expanding, signaling increased volatility ahead. Immediate support is located near $249, while overhead resistance stands around $290.
